设想:
用户给您一个电子邮件地址。在他们注册服务之前,他们需要验证电子邮件地址 - 您通过电子邮件发送一个 URL,他们单击它,然后他们就可以订阅服务。
问题:
网址是什么样的?我认为随机指南就可以了。
您是否使用相同的随机密钥来取消订阅请求?
我应该考虑是否有任何好的双选开源实现?
在此之前,我曾使用随机 GUID 来验证电子邮件帐户,效果很好。除非您正在处理超安全、超敏感的数据,否则它应该足够了。我认为没有理由不使用相同的 GUID 来取消订阅请求 - 这样您只需为每个帐户存储一个 GUID,即可查找您的订阅者数据库(或者以任何方式存储它们)。您可以将取消订阅链接添加到所有电子邮件的底部,使其成为一个简单的一键选项。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)